quick question
so yea a buddy of mine just bought a dual stage nitrous ystem... 100- 150 shot. Its a 99 a4 which is pretty much stock except for exhaust, lid, small cam etc, and a slipping tranny (told him he should get a new tranny and gears first but whatever). Will this dumbass be ok to run this setup or are there any mods that should be made prior
sorry for not searching because i am sure this has been covered i jsut really dont have time because i am at work
thanks for all help
-
10-20-2006, 02:16 PM #2
With a slipping transmission. No
As far as the motor goes, don't start spraying until 3000 and shut it off at 6000. Or you could just buy a window switch, pressure switch, bottle warmer, remote opener and all the stuff to be safest. Well, not the remote bottle opener, that is more of a luxury. The motor will be fine.
